Subject: DR Drill — StormRelay Fan-Out Recovery

Team,

Thursday's disaster-recovery drill will simulate a full outage of the StormRelay weather-alert fan-out in the Kestrel region. We will fail over to the warm standby, verify alert delivery within the five-minute SLA, and then restore the primary queue. Please confirm your pager rotation before Wednesday and review the runbook section on replaying missed alerts. To unseal the standby's credential vault during the exercise, use the passphrase below.

vault phrase of bagaf-kajeg = jorath-feniel-briir-siliel-ralix

// Conversion rates from the Marnet FX service come back as floats,
// which caused the rounding drift we saw in the Q3 ledger mismatch.
// Always convert to integer minor units before summing, and round
// half-even per the Tillbrook accounting policy. The client below
// fetches rates from Marnet's internal endpoint; do not use the
// public mirror, as it truncates to four decimal places. New team
// members: the client authenticates with the key on the next line.

service key, bajog-yahop: kto7_mMHVCpJ

## Approvals: Consent Banner Rollout (Project Lumengate)

The phased rollout of the Lumengate consent banner covers all public-facing pages on the Brightmere portal. Each phase requires documented sign-off: legal review of banner copy, verification that consent state is stored before any non-essential scripts load, and confirmation that the opt-out path functions in all supported locales. Security review must confirm no tracking beacons fire prior to consent. No phase may proceed without written approval from the accountable owner, named below.

account owner for kafop-haweg: Pelax Gilael Istir

Handover Note — Director Transition, Quillon Appliances

The warranty-cost overrun on the Marnette dishwasher range remains the most pressing item. Claims are running 40% above provision, traced to a gasket supplier change made last spring. I have commissioned a failure analysis, paused the supplier contract, and increased the reserve pending results. Regional service partners have been briefed but not customers. The strategic implications, which you should treat as sensitive, are set out below.

board note of yadup-fajef: Druiusox Holdings is in early talks to buy Norwynek Systems for about $186.0 million. The Kaseth launch date is June 24, and nothing goes to the press before then. Legal wants the Quenethek Group term sheet withdrawn before November 27.